Analysis
The most recent figure for quasi-money, money plus quasi-money (depository corporations survey) in Poland is 1.26 units per US$ of GDP, measured in 2008.
That represents a change of down 4.4% on the previous year and down 2.8% over ten years.
Over the whole period, quasi-money, money plus quasi-money (depository corporations survey) in Poland peaked at 1.81 units per US$ of GDP in 2001 and was at its lowest, 0.2963 units per US$ of GDP, in 1990.
That places Poland 132nd out of 159 countries with data for 2008, putting it in the bottom quarter.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 19 years of available data.

How this figure is calculated
Quasi-Money, Money plus Quasi-Money (Depository Corporations Survey, Domestic currency) divided by GDP (current US$), matched on country and year. Neither publisher issues this ratio as a series; it is computed here from both.
Quasi-Money, Money plus Quasi-Money (Depository Corporations Survey, Domestic currency) ÷ GDP (current US$)
Computed from
- Quasi-Money, Money plus Quasi-Money International Monetary Fund
- GDP Country official statistics, National Statistical Organizations and/or Central Banks
Statizoid computes this series; the underlying measurements belong to the publishers named above. The arithmetic is applied to every country and year where both inputs report, and nothing is estimated unless the page says so.
